What's Happening?
Usha Vance, the second lady and wife of Vice President JD Vance, announced that she is expecting their fourth child. The couple shared the news on Instagram, expressing excitement about the upcoming addition to their family. Usha Vance, who has a background
in law, previously worked for Munger, Tolles & Olson LLP and clerked for Chief Justice John Roberts. The Vances, who met at Yale Law School, have three children: Ewan, Vivek, and Mirabel. The announcement included gratitude towards military doctors and staff who have supported their family.
